The Global Pitch-based Carbon Fiber Precursor Market was valued at USD 112 Million in 2024 and is projected to reach USD 277 Million by 2032, growing at a Compound Annual Growth Rate (CAGR) of 14.9% during the forecast period. This exceptional growth is being driven by soaring demand from aerospace, wind energy, and advanced mobility sectors that require materials offering ultra-high stiffness, superior thermal conductivity, and unparalleled weight savings.

3️⃣ 8. Kureha Corporation

Headquarters: Tokyo, Japan
Key Offering: Specialty petroleum pitch, High-softening-point pitch feedstocks

Kureha Corporation occupies a unique and critical niche as a leading supplier of high-quality petroleum pitch, the essential raw material for many pitch-based carbon fiber precursors. The company’s technology in controlling the molecular structure of its pitch products makes it a key enabler for fiber manufacturers seeking consistency and high performance in their final carbon fiber.

Market Leadership & Innovation:

  • Dominant supplier of premium carbon fiber-grade petroleum pitch

  • Proprietary delayed coking and purification technologies

  • Strategic R&D partnerships with downstream carbon fiber producers

1️⃣ 10. Nippon Graphite Fiber Corporation

Headquarters: Tokyo, Japan
Key Offering: Granoc® pitch-based carbon fibers, Isotropic & mesophase precursors

Nippon Graphite Fiber, a subsidiary of Mitsubishi Chemical, specializes in the production of isotropic pitch-based carbon fibers, which are distinct from the mesophase pitch fibers that dominate aerospace. These fibers excel in thermal insulation, friction materials, and high-purity applications, showcasing the versatility of pitch-based technology beyond structural composites.

Market Leadership & Innovation:

  • World leader in isotropic pitch-based carbon fiber production

  • Critical supplier for semiconductor and industrial furnace applications

  • Continuous development of fiber grades for emerging thermal and sealing markets


🌍 Outlook: The Future of Advanced Composites is High-Performance and Strategic

The pitch-based carbon fiber precursor market is at an inflection point. While it serves a more specialized niche than its PAN-based counterpart, its role is becoming increasingly strategic as performance requirements escalate across aviation, energy, and advanced technology. The competitive landscape is defined by deep technological expertise, significant capital barriers, and complex supply chain integrations.

📈 Key Trends Shaping the Market:

  • Geopolitical Reshoring: Intensifying focus on securing domestic precursor supply chains in the US, Europe, and Japan for aerospace and defense.

  • Application Diversification: Expansion beyond traditional aerospace into thermal management for EVs/5G, large-scale wind blades, and hydrogen storage.

  • Feedstock Innovation: Accelerated R&D into synthetic pitch and bio-based pitch alternatives to reduce reliance on petroleum and coal tar.

  • Process Digitalization: Adoption of AI and advanced process control to manage the extreme precision required in precursor manufacturing, aiming to improve yield and reduce cost.
